North and South Korean soldiers cross DMZ to inspect dismantled guard posts

North and South Korean soldiers on Wednesday, December 12, crossed the demilitarized zone (DMZ ) between the two countries to inspect the dismantling of guard posts, Seoul reported. The peaceful visits and inspections – the first since the Korean War – were part of the agreement that each country would remove 10 guard posts along the DMZ and preserve one on each side, including the one previously visited by North Korean leader Kim Jong Un.
